| Salesforce is experiencing significant growth and market success, driven by the rapid adoption of its AI features, particularly Agentforce. The company's integration of AI in its software offerings has been positively received, enhancing product competitiveness and revenue potential. However, there are concerns regarding the potential displacement of existing software as AI continues to evolve, which necessitates careful management. Overall, the advancements in AI and Cloud technologies are pivotal to Salesforce's ongoing product development strategies. |
| The price action of Salesforce (CRM) is impacted by broad market risk appetite, sector price trend, company-specific performance and market structure. The trend sentiment at 3 is extremely bullish. The market sentiment at 1.3 is very bullish. Trend sentiment measures the current trend of the stock price, and market sentiment reflects what market participants collectively think where the price will move next.CRM is likely to move up since both trend sentiment and market sentiment are positive. The positive sentiment force for sector is at 1.5, and the negative at -0.2 on 2025-12-05. The forces of Sentiment towards Fundamentals (3.6), Stock Price Trend (3), Sector Price Trend (1.3), Option Sentiment (1.2), and Valuation Sentiment (0.3) will drive up the price. The forces of Market Risk Appetite (-0.3), and Price Level Sentiment (-1) will drive down the price. The sentiment for Sector Price Trend is calculated based on the price trend of related sector ETF. The sentiment for Option Speculation is calculated from put/call ratio. The Risk Appetite is calculated from Bitcoin price trend. Price Level sentiment is positive when oversold, and negative when overbought. Valuation Sentiment, and Sentimentals towards Fundamentals are extracted from headlines and market commentary. All sentiment scores are normalized on a -10 - +10 scale. The price level reaches 100 at Bollinger upper band, and zero at lower band. |

| Long is the preferred trading strategy with 60% chance of being right. Both trend sentiment and hourly trend are very strong. Wait action is recommended in three scenarios with either high uncertainty or high risk: 1. The trend sentiment and market sentiment are at the opposite directions. 2. Both trend sentiment and market sentiment are positive, but the price level is elevated. 3. Both trend sentiment and market sentiment are negative, but the price level is depressed. In an uptrend, as an investor, you may want to wait for the pullback to open long position. In a downtrend, the price will likely rebound after huge decline. As an investor, you may want to wait for the rebound to exit long position. | |||||||||||||
| Market sentiment will accelerate the current trend when both trend sentiment and market sentiment are at the same direction. Market sentiment will generate volatility when it's at the opposite direction of the trend sentiment. News sentiment measures the daily emotion of the market. News sentiment may impact the daily price change while market sentiment is a more stable and consistent moving force. | |||||||||||||
